Mesothelioma Claim

A mesothelioma suit is an opportunity to receive compensation for asbestos-related damage. Victims and their families can be awarded financial compensation through the verdict of a jury, a settlement that is negotiated or a VA claim or an asbestos trust fund award.

Compensation can cover the cost of cancer treatment and offer financial aid. It also assists families with other costs associated with this disease.

Workers are entitled to compensation

Workers' compensation insurance is a kind of insurance that provides financial benefits to those who are injured at work. This type of benefit can cover medical bills and lost wages. However, it doesn't usually include compensation for pain and suffering or punitive damages. Some states also limit the length of time that a worker has to apply for workers' compensation.

Mesothelioma lawyers are able to assist patients and their families with filing for mesothelioma benefits. They can also help patients to understand the different kinds of benefits they can claim. This includes personal injury lawsuits, asbestos trust funds and workers' compensation.

The majority of patients with mesothelioma can file a personal injuries lawsuit against asbestos-related companies that exposed them to the disease. The lawsuits are usually divided into two types: economic and noneconomic damages. The financial awards in the first category are based on the cost of treatment, lost income, and documented expenses related to a mesothelioma-related diagnosis. Noneconomic damages are awarded to compensate a plaintiff's physical and emotional stress, their loss of enjoyment of living and other losses resulting from intangibles.

People who have been identified as having mesothelioma, or another asbestos-related condition, can apply for benefits for veterans or workers compensation. They can also apply for asbestos trust funds. This kind of aid is often required due to the high price of mesothelioma therapies. Treatment grants can help offset these expenses, in addition to other expenses, such as living and travel costs. Health insurance and disability coverage can also cover some of the costs associated with treatment. However, these insurance programs are not the same as mesothelioma lawsuits, and are difficult to navigate without the help of a seasoned attorney.

Personal injury lawsuits

Patients suffering from mesothelioma are able to be able to sue the companies that exposed them to asbestos. These lawsuits are intended to hold companies accountable for their negligence. They may also seek compensation for medical expenses, lost income and other losses. In some states the estate of a mesothelioma patient may pursue their personal injury lawsuit.

In the mesothelioma lawsuit process, patients will work with experienced attorneys who can assist them in finding evidence of asbestos exposure from their past employers. The plaintiff will be required to collect documentation, including medical records, a history of work and the testimonies of coworkers and family members. The information will be used to determine the value of a claim.

When a mesothelioma suit is filed, defendants will be given a time limit to respond. The time frame for responding to a mesothelioma lawsuit is different from state to. The defendant may choose to agree to a settlement outside of court with the plaintiff or challenge the claims, which will start the trial process.

If the defendant is unable to reach a settlement with the plaintiff, he will be required by law to pay a certain amount of money to the victim. This payment is called a compensation award. The money is usually awarded in a lump sum and can be used to pay medical expenses as well as loss of income funeral expenses. Mesothelioma awards can also include non-economic damages, like discomfort and pain, as well as loss of consortium.

Although there have been some class action lawsuits in the past most mesothelioma claims are dealt with as individual lawsuits. However, some cases may be merged into a multidistrict litigation or MDL, for greater effectiveness.

Trust funds

If asbestos exposure victims are suffering from an asbestos-related disease they might be able to receive compensation from trust funds. The funds can be obtained from companies who have declared bankruptcy. It is essential to speak with an attorney. Attorneys are familiar with the intricacies of mesothelioma trust fund and can ensure that their clients receive the maximum compensation possible.

These trusts can also compensate other asbestos-related diseases. These funds can be used to pay for treatment, funeral costs and lost wages. They also can cover injuries and pain. Trusts offer these benefits on a "first-in-first-out" basis which means that victims who file claims first will receive the greatest compensation.

Asbestos lawsuits can be complicated and require thorough research which is why it is crucial to consult with a lawyer prior to filing. Lawyers who have experience in mesothelioma can help you navigate the law and deadlines. They can also assist in finding the documents and medical records needed for the claim.

The amount you are paid will depend on the nature of your illness and your history of exposure. Trusts set percentages of payment to ensure there is enough money to cover future claims. These percentages are built on the assumption that there will be an average award value for each disease. However, they can be adjusted when the financial condition of a trust changes.

The asbestos attorneys at a mesothelioma law company can help you determine the time, place and manner in which you were exposed to asbestos. They can also assist you prepare the required paperwork and ensure that your mesothelioma claim is dealt with quickly. They can also help you navigate the complicated process of making a claim from an asbestos trust fund.

Disability benefits

Compensation for mesothelioma could assist patients, their families, and caregivers cover living expenses, household bills, lost income as well as caregiving and other related costs. It can also provide financial security in the case of a patient's death. Three major types of mesothelioma settlements are trust funds, lawsuits and settlements. Choosing an experienced mesothelioma law firm to file a claim could ensure that victims receive the highest amount of compensation in a reasonable amount of time.

If a mesothelioma patient is able to meet the SSDI eligibility requirements they will be required to submit medical evidence to support their condition. The most reliable evidence is a pathology report that positively can identify mesothelioma tumor cells in a biopsy. Other documents that be used to prove mesothelioma include hospital reports, doctor notes, and statements from family.

The SSA will also review a person's ability to work and determine their prognosis prior to awarding disability benefits. If the mesothelioma patient is incapable of working and is unable to work, they are entitled to monthly disability checks. These benefits are based upon the average lifetime earnings they contributed to Social Security. Mesothelioma patients could also be eligible for state-based disability and supplemental assistance that is not funded by Social Security.

A mesothelioma lawyer can assist clients with the disability claim process of the SSA and assist clients gather the necessary medical documentation. The lawyer can also assist with submitting applications for veterans benefits, workers' compensation, and the asbestos trust fund. They can also assist clients apply for SSI (a program based on needs that is open to those with very limited incomes and assets). They can also assist them to apply for tax refunds due to mesothelioma. An attorney for mesothelioma can assist their client in filing for the Aid and Assistance (A&A), which allows those suffering from the disease to receive money to hire someone to help them around the home.
